The Talaria XXX and E Ride Pro S are the closest class competitors in electric dirt bikes. The XXX produces 6.5kW at 47 mph and weighs just 121 lbs. The Pro S produces 6kW at 50 mph and weighs 136 lbs. Where the Pro S pulls ahead: 41-62 miles of range versus 30-55, belt drive versus chain, 2-hour fast charging, and Send Bikes dealer warranty — all at $3,999 versus $3,100-$4,300.

Power & Speed

Even

Talaria XXX

6.5kW peak, 47 mph — slightly more peak power

E Ride Pro S

6kW peak, 50 mph — 3 mph faster top speed

The XXX has 0.5kW more peak power, the Pro S has 3 mph more top speed. In practice, these bikes feel very similar in acceleration and riding feel. This is as close to a tie as you'll find in electric dirt bike comparisons. The real differences are in range, drivetrain, and ownership.

Range & Battery

E Ride Pro S wins

Talaria XXX

30-55 miles on 1920Wh battery

E Ride Pro S

41-62 miles on 2160Wh battery

The Pro S delivers 13-20% more range thanks to its slightly larger battery and efficient belt drive. At the low end, that's 11 extra miles. At the high end, 7 extra miles. For longer rides, those extra miles add up and can mean the difference between making it home or not.

Weight & Handling

Talaria XXX wins

Talaria XXX

121 lbs — one of the lightest e-motos available

E Ride Pro S

136 lbs — still light with better range-to-weight

The XXX is 15 lbs lighter, which is a real advantage for loading, tight trails, and smaller riders. At 121 lbs, it's among the lightest electric dirt bikes you can buy. The Pro S at 136 lbs is no heavyweight, but the XXX wins the weight argument clearly.

Service & Warranty

The Pro S ships with Send Bikes dealer warranty and support through Central Georgia Powersports. Talaria XXX warranty varies by dealer. The Pro S's belt drive eliminates the chain maintenance that the XXX requires.

Financing & Ownership

The Pro S can be financed through Terrace Finance. Talaria XXX financing depends on your dealer. The Pro S's belt drive saves ongoing chain costs — lubing, adjustments, and replacement every 2,000-3,000 miles on the XXX.
